cusco or whiteline...

i was wondering, what would be better, a whiteline, or a cusco rear sway bar? ive seen the whiteline adjusts, does the cusco one, as well? and do they some in diff colors? someone anyone please, thank you.

I got a whiteline 20-24mm adjustable. Its great. I feel like I have much more control over the car. In my experience, although a bit easier to deal with, understeer has a bigger surprise element. Surprises suck. It installed easily.

Here's a tip I thought of before I installed it:

I painted my pretty blue new bar with flat black paint. Why? Thieves like pretty, colorful bling bling. Looks bone stock. Handles much better.
